MSSQL快速轻松获取表结构方法(mssql 获取表结构)
SQL Server数据库是当下备受欢迎的关系型数据库系统。在使用SQL Server的日常运维工作中,获取表结构是一项必不可少的工作,用于分析表中列和索引的属性,以及查找支持选择,更新,删除和插入等查询时必要的字段信息。在本文中,我们将介绍更快捷、更轻松的获取SQL Server表结构的方法。
首先,要获取某个表的结构,管理员或开发者可以使用T-SQL脚本,执行下面的查询语句:
“`sql
SELECT COLUMN_NAME, DATA_TYPE, CHARACTER_MAXIMUM_LENGTH
FROM INFORMATION_SCHEMA.COLUMNS
WHERE TABLE_NAME = ‘Table_Name’
通过上述语句可以查看表的各行的信息,包括列名、数据类型和字符串类型列的最大长度。
其次,如果要查看表的索引信息,只需要执行下列查询:```sql
SELECT * FROM sys.indexes
WHERE OBJECT_ID = OBJECT_ID ('Table_Name') ORDER BY INDEX_ID ASC
通过上述查询语句可以获取到表中索引的各种属性,如唯一索引,允许空值,表名,字段名等。
最后,如果要查看表中字段属性,可以使用sp_help 存储过程(储存过程)。只需执行以下代码:
“`sql
exec sp_help ’Table_Name’
该存储过程会列出每一列的描述性信息,包括类型,大小,默认值,标识,允许空值等。通过sp_help 过程可以让管理员或开发者快速熟悉表中的所有字段属性,从而让快速管理和开发。
从上述内容可以看出,SQL Server拥有许多简便、有效的获取表结构的方法,只要选择合适的方法,管理员和开发者可以轻松熟悉和获取表中列和索引的属性。